Structure membrane bracing of a framing structure is achieved by mounting a flexible membrane to at least part of the framing structure using fasteners and/or adhesive. The flexible membrane is a thin sheet, such as a fabric, that may be supplied as a roll and/or as folded sheets. Unlike conventional rigid panel products, the flexible membrane is flexible in nature and may be tightly rolled or folded in a compact manner to facilitate transport and mounting. The structural membrane bracing provides a wall, floor, or roof bracing element with a nominal unit seismic shear capacity of 50 Vs (plf), or a nominal unit wind shear capacity of 50 VW (plf), or greater. The flexible membrane may also function as a water-resistive barrier, thereby removing the need for conventional water-resistive membrane layers.
